Job description

POSITION TITLE: Patient Care Technician (PCT)/ Nurse Tech (NT)/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A)

Position reports to: Clinical Nurse Manager

Degree of Supervision Provided to Position: Must be self-directed and work under direction of the Clinical Nurse Manager

Duties / Responsibilities
  • Comply with the facility policies and procedures.
  • Function as an assistive person by:
  • Protecting the patient from injury caused by extraneous objects and chemical, electrical, mechanical and thermal sources.
  • Demonstrating safe operation of equipment machinery and follows procedures for reporting and correcting an unsafe situation.
  • Speaking up with safety concerns acting as the patient’s advocate.
  • Handling specimens according to facility policy and procedures
  • Adhering to standard precautions including the use of personal protective equipment.
  • Performing interventions to protect the patient from infection.
  • Assembling supplies and equipment;
  • Assuming an active role in assisting patient with care needs;
  • Proactively optimizes opportunities to enhance flow and efficiency of the center;
  • Orienting patient to environment;
  • Maintaining patient normothermia;
  • Assisting with patient transfers;
  • Assisting throughout the facility in environmental cleaning;
  • Protecting the patient’s rights, dignity, and privacy
  • Providing age-specific, culturally competent, ethical care within legal standards of practice.
  • Complying with Universal Protocol and facility site validation and time-out policy.
  • Notifying the RN of any observed changes in patient’s status and responses.
  • Provide hand-off report to other teammates that are accurate, concise and pertinent to the patient’s condition and response to care.
  • Document the episode of care accurately, timely, completely, and legibly.
  • Monitor vital signs and recognize emergencies and notify the Registered Nurse.
  • Clean and prepare equipment according to manufacturer’s instructions for use.
  • Demonstrate effective communication and collaboration skills with members of the team and other stakeholders.
  • Serve as a member of a multidisciplinary team in patient care.
  • Participate in quality review and performance improvement projects.
  • Participate in the performance appraisal process.
  • Use problem-solving and conflict resolution skills to foster effective work relationships.
  • Act as a patient advocate and maintain privacy and confidentiality of individuals and health information.
  • Comply with all facility policies and procedures, regulatory and accreditation standards and professional guidelines when providing patient care.
  • Actively participate in team meetings, training and daily safety huddles.
  • Demonstrate fiscal responsibility.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
Working Conditions / Physical Requirements
  • Physically demanding, high-stress environment
  • Exposure to blood and body fluids, communicable diseases, chemicals, radiation, and repetitive motions
  • Pushing and pulling heavy objects
  • Full range of body motion including handling and lifting patients and equipment
  • Hand eye coordination
  • Standing and walking for extensive periods of time
  • Lifting and carrying items weighing up to 50lbs.
  • Corrected vision and hearing to within normal range
  • Working irregular hours
